Two Trials

By R.D. Glenn | September 13, 2026

In Mark 14:53–72, Jesus stands faithfully before His accusers while Peter, under pressure, denies even knowing Him. The contrast exposes our own weakness and failure, but it also points us to the heart of the gospel. Our hope is not found in our ability to remain faithful, but in the faithfulness of Jesus Christ, who remained obedient to the Father and faithful to His people all the way to the cross. When we fail, we have a faithful Savior.

A Beautiful Thing

By R.D. Glenn | August 23, 2026

In Mark 14:1–11, we see a striking contrast between betrayal and devotion. Judas was close to Jesus, yet betrayed him, while an unnamed woman poured out a costly and extravagant gift in worship. What makes her devotion so beautiful? She understood that Jesus was going to the cross to die for her. Her costly gift was a response to his even greater gift of himself. We live for him because he died for us.
